Kinds of Welder’s Certifications
Although the American Welding Society’s regular CW card helps make you eligible for the majority of job opportunities, specific fields require their own specialized certification. Some of the most-popular of them appear below.
- American Petroleum Institute Certification for those who deal with pipelines in the gas and oil field
- American Society of Mechanical Engineers Certification for welders who deal with boiler and pressure vessels
- SCWI and CWI Certifications for inspectors and senior inspectors
- Certified Welder Certificates to become a Certified Welder

The following table shows job and earnings forecasts for professional welders in the State of Oklahoma through the end of the decade.
| Oklahoma | Employment | |||
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2012 | 2022 | Change | Annual Job Openings | |
|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ers | 10,500 | 11,700 | 11% | 380 |
| Oklahoma | Annual Salary | ||
|---|---|---|---|
| Low | Median | High | |
|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ers |
$23,800 | $36,000 | $56,000 |
Source: O*Net Online

Before you sign anything with the welding specialist training program you have selected, it’s heavily encouraged that you take the time to look at the accreditation status of the program with the AWS. Some other areas that you may possibly have to look at aside from the accreditation status are:
- Choose colleges that satisfy AWS SENSE standards
- Be sure the school trains with tools that satisfies present industry requirements
- See if the school gives financial assistance
- Confirm the college’s curriculum provides you with courses in SMAW, GMAW, GTAW and pipe welding
